I have been feeling like this for 15 years. I have kept most of it bottled up. I have an excellent therapist who has been helping me come out of my shell. I finally told her last week I am not a women. Today we talked about my options. She brought my mom in. I told her I’ve been keeping it to myself because in 2011 I told an abusive therapist I wanted to be a man and she told me I was just confused. It really traumatized me. My therapist and I are going to be working with another doctor who will help me get on hormone treatments. I will eventually get a mastectomy. But I got the diagnosis today of gender dysphoric disorder. My mom supports me. And I know the rest of my family will too. I am so thankful to my therapist for helping me out.

Ok, not being familiar with this process, please, help me understand. The hormones will help you develop manly features? Please, feel free to PM me if you prefer.
@HappyCrafter Yes that is correct. My body shape will change, my breasts will shrink and I’ll start developing facial hair. Eventually I’ll get a full mastectomy. I’d like to get a hysterectomy but my hospital is unable to do that part due to religious reasons.
